Mean of frequency distribution Σf_i x_i / Σf_i. Find mean of: 2(×3), 4(×5), 6(×2): values 2,4,6 with frequencies 3, 5, 2:
A4
B6
C(6+20+12)/10 = 38/10 = 3.8
D5
Answer & Solution
Correct answer: C. (6+20+12)/10 = 38/10 = 3.8
Σf_i = 10. Σf_i x_i = 2(3) + 4(5) + 6(2) = 6 + 20 + 12 = 38. Mean = 38/10 = 3.8.
